EDITORS COMMENTS
In this image from the Emirates Stadium, the focus is on Arsenal's goalkeeper, David Ospina, during the FA Cup 5th Round match against Hull City on February 20,2016. The tension in the air is palpable as the score remained goalless between the two teams. Ospina, with his determined expression and steady gaze, is poised and ready to defend his goalpost. The crowd is on the edge of their seats, their eyes fixed on the action unfolding before them. The FA Cup 5th Round is a significant stage in the English football competition, and for Arsenal, it represented an opportunity to advance further in the tournament. The team's defense, led by Ospina, was under immense pressure to keep a clean sheet and secure a win. The Colombian international goalkeeper had already proven himself to be a valuable asset to the team, with his impressive performances throughout the season. The atmosphere inside the Emirates Stadium was electric, with the fans cheering and urging their team on. The air was filled with anticipation, as every save, every pass, and every shot on target became a potential turning point in the game. Ospina's calm demeanor and unwavering focus were a source of inspiration for his teammates and the fans alike. Despite the intense pressure, Ospina remained focused, making crucial saves and organizing his defense to keep Hull City at bay. The final whistle blew, and the match ended in a goalless draw, setting the stage for a thrilling replay at the KC Stadium. This image captures the essence of the FA Cup and the unwavering determination of Arsenal's goalkeeper, David Ospina, to help his team advance in the competition.
